Abstract

The utility model proposes a kind of four core type ellipsoidal structure transformers of resistance to shorting impact, it include: four core type oval-shaped iron cores and machine body structure, wherein, machine body structure includes: three groups of coils, lateral briquetting, longitudinal briquetting, iron yoke insulation piece, wherein, three groups of coils are assemblied on four core type oval-shaped iron cores, it is stoppered among every group of coil using circle bamboo stick, it is circular arc outside the inside and high-pressure side of coil, it is separated between adjacent windings using phase partition, lateral briquetting is looped around the outside of iron yoke insulation piece, multiple groups iron yoke partition is equipped in iron yoke insulation piece, multiple groups iron yoke partition is mounted on the centre of longitudinal briquetting, lateral briquetting and longitudinal briquetting are oval structure to push down overhang, coil is prevented to be subjected to displacement.The utility model uses oval coil and oval-shaped iron core close fit, is not susceptible to relative displacement after coil and iron core stretching, and effectively improves the ability that low-voltage coil bears short-circuit impact.

Background technique
Traditional transformer device structure is generally divided into circular configuration and two kinds of oblong structure.The transformer of both structures point The following defects and deficiencies exist:
(1) transformer uses circular configuration, and coil width is circle to section, causes body space utilization rate low, is lost Height, it is at high cost.
(2) transformer uses oblong structure, and coil width is oblong to section, leads to coil resistance to shorting impact capacity Difference, coil is easily-deformable after by short-circuit force, is easy to appear accident.If coil is excessively unsmooth, line by oval variation ellipse structure Circle resistance to shorting impact capacity is poor, and coil is easily-deformable after by short-circuit force, is prone to accidents, and safety is poor.

Four core type ellipsoidal structure transformers of the resistance to shorting impact of the utility model embodiment, comprising: four core types are oval Shape iron core and machine body structure.Wherein, machine body structure includes: three groups of coils, lateral briquetting, longitudinal briquetting, iron yoke insulation piece.
As shown in Figure 1, Figure 2 and Figure 3, three groups of coils are assemblied on four core type oval-shaped iron cores, are used among every group of coil Circle bamboo stick stoppers, and is circular arc outside the inside and high-pressure side of coil.Wherein, the width of coil is ellipse to section, is closely filled It fits on oval-shaped iron core.Iron core includes iron yoke 1 and stem 2.Preferably, the centre of iron core is stoppered using 5 layers of round bamboo stick, is prevented Coil and iron core relative displacement, prevent winding deformation.
As shown in Figure 4, Figure 5, Figure 6 and Figure 7, it is separated between adjacent windings using phase partition 6, lateral briquetting 4 is looped around The outside of 1 insulating part of iron yoke, 1 insulating part of iron yoke is interior to be equipped with multiple groups iron yoke partition 3, and multiple groups iron yoke partition 3 is mounted on longitudinal briquetting 5 Centre.
Specifically, iron yoke partition 3 includes: web 7 as shown in Figure 10 a, Figure 10 b and Figure 11, in the upper and lower two sides of web 7 It is separately installed with a pair of of triangle cardboard, two groups of 8 components of stay are symmetrically installed on web 7.Every group of 8 component of stay include: Six stays 8, wherein four stays 8 positioned at outside are aligned with the bevel edge of triangle cardboard 9, two stays 8 and web of inside The alignment of 7 bottom plate.The both sides of the iron yoke partition 3 of the utility model are provided with class oval structure, sufficiently push down end turn, prevent Only coil upper and lower displacement.
Fig. 8 a and Fig. 8 b are the main view and top view according to the lateral briquetting 4 of the utility model embodiment.Fig. 9 a, Fig. 9 b With main view, top view and the side view that Fig. 9 c is according to longitudinal briquetting 5 of the utility model embodiment.
With reference to above-mentioned attached drawing, lateral briquetting 4 and longitudinal briquetting 5 are oval structure, effectively push down overhang, prevent Only upper and lower displacement occurs for coil.In the embodiments of the present invention, oil guide groove is offered on lateral briquetting 4 and longitudinal briquetting 5, Convenient for the flowing of coil interior insulation liquid, heat-sinking capability is improved.

Four core type ellipsoidal structure transformers of the resistance to shorting impact of the utility model embodiment, using four core types ellipse Structure, coil be everywhere circular arc and it is gentle excessively, inherit the good mechanical strength of circular configuration, be not easy after each position stress Deformation.The advantages of ellipsoidal structure has both oblong structure " small phase spacing " simultaneously, reduces M0 size, improves the sky of body Between utilization rate, the cost of product is effectively reduced.
